The NSA's Reach Might Be Even Bigger Than We Thought

"Now, new research from Stanford graduate students Jonathan Mayer and Patrick Mutchler suggests that the NSA's dragnet could be bigger -- much bigger.

"Under current FISA Court orders, the NSA may be able to analyze the phone records of a sizable proportion of the United States population with just one seed number," they wrote in a blog post published Monday. "And by the way, there are tens of thousands of qualified seed numbers.""
